Dear Abby: My friend doesn’t want to interfere with her daughter’s abusive marriage
In a recent Dear Abby column, a reader expresses concern for her friend whose daughter is trapped in an abusive marriage and is hesitant to leave her husband. This situation highlights the complexities of familial relationships and the challenges faced by those in abusive situations. It matters because it sheds light on the importance of support systems and the need for open conversations about domestic abuse.
